Overview
The ATSAMD21G18A-AFT is a 32-bit microcontroller based on the ARM Cortex-M0+ core, designed for functional safety applications. It operates at frequencies up to 48 MHz and features 256 KB of in-system programmable flash memory alongside 32 KB of SRAM. The device supports a supply voltage range of 1.62V to 3.6V and includes advanced analog peripherals such as 14-channel 12-bit ADCs and a 10-bit DAC. It is housed in a 48-TQFP package with an operating temperature range extending to 125°C.

Selection Notes
Select this component when functional safety certification is mandatory for the application. Choose this model over standard SAM D21 variants if operation above 85°C is required. Opt for this part when 256 KB of flash is necessary for complex firmware or large data tables. Consider this MCU for designs needing integrated USB capabilities combined with high-resolution analog input channels.

Replacement Considerations
ATSAMD21G18A-AU offers identical specifications with an 85°C temperature rating. ATSAMD21G18A-AUT provides similar features with automotive qualification. ATSAMD21G16B-AFT serves as a lower-memory alternative within the same package.
